Yes To Release Latter-Day Box Set In December
Date: Sunday, December 10 @ 23:04:17 UTC
Topic: Album Release News


As forwarded by Alquimia 104 and written by Bruce Simon:

Yes will release a five-disc box set of their latter-day albums next month [now this month]. The Essentially Yes package has complete versions of their most recent studio albums -- 1994's Talk, 1997's Open Your Eyes, 1999's The Ladder, and 2001's Magnification -- as well as an unreleased live show from the Montreux Jazz Festival in Switzerland in 2003 that mixes older and newer material. Essentially Yes [came] out December 5th.



Yes is on hiatus, and there's no word on when the band will reconvene.

The Montreux concert in Essentially Yes includes "Siberian Khatru," "Magnification," "Don't Kill The Whale," "In The Presence Of," "We Have Heaven," "South Side Of The Sky," "And You And I," "Awaken," and "I've Seen All Good People."

Plus, addeth PW, here you can see the cover artwork, remiscent of that for Open Your Eyes with the classic Roger Dean typography. Comments regarding this set (seen at Amazon.com) say there are none of the original liner notes included with the CDs, just sleeves with the artwork; no info that the albums have been remastered or the like; and there is no bonus material appended to these reissues. That leaves the 5th disc, the live recording from 2003, as the real lure... but... good performance? Bad performance? Is the sound good or bad?

The set has been issued by Eagle Rock.
